ceramic (stoneware), ash glaze ("anagama" kiln), sign.
The pottery Thomas Henle exists since 1979, since 1990 it is situated in a small town near Wurzburg.
In his more than 30 years of creative work, Henle, in his constant search for new types of artistic expression, draws on medieval forms while employing a wide variety of ceramic techniques.
In this way, his Japanese ceramics line was created, which includes the production of ceramics using the "raku" technique as well producing tea ceramic pottery. Traditional forms and techniques of Japanese ceramic art are taken up and reinterpreted by Henle.
